计算机病毒与恶意代码
计算机病毒与恶意代码
5000+ 人选课
更新日期:2025/02/11
开课时间2024/09/30 - 2024/11/30
课程周期9 周
开课状态已结课
每周学时-
课程简介

(1)我为什么要学习这门课?

  恶意代码作为信息安全领域的重要一环,近年来在组织对抗、国家博弈、社会稳定方面发挥了双刃剑的作用,引起了社会各界的广泛重视。通过这门课同学们可以了解勒索软件、APT等最新的恶意代码,也会学到传统恶意代码的原理。

(2)这门课的主题是关于什么?

  本课程主要讲解恶意代码的基本概念、技术发展和运行机制。在分析恶意代码技术的基础上,讲解了恶意代码的检测和清除技术。此外,还对预防恶意代码的策略和防治方案进行了讲述。

(3)学习这门课可以获得什么?特别是对自己有什么帮助和应用。

    本课程总共12个章节,包括恶意代码的概述,模型及传播机理,传统计算机病毒,Linux系统下的恶意代码,移动终端恶意代码,也包括新颖的蠕虫、木马、僵尸网络、APT等;此外,也包括恶意代码的防范技术及防范策略等。

    通过学习本课程,同学能够掌握恶意代码的基本技术,在日常的系统维护中,能够游刃有余地应对由恶意代码引发的各种安全威胁,并能给出合理的防范恶意代码的方法和方案。

(4)这门课有什么特色和亮点。

    课程主要内容来源于本人大学本科计算机病毒和恶意代码10多年教学经验,多年恶意代码及其防范研究基础,以及前期编写的4本教材。课程的参考教材《计算机病毒与恶意代码(第4版)》被多所高校作为教材,得到了大家的支持和认可。该教材也分别获得了“上海交通大学优秀教材特等奖”、“上海市高等教育教材一等奖”。

课程大纲

第一章 计算机病毒与恶意代码概述

1.1概念及特征

1.2 恶意代码发展史

实验用虚拟机视频

单元作业

第二章 恶意代码理论模型

2.1 恶意代码理论模型

第二章 恶意代码理论模型(2)

2.2 蠕虫模型

2.3预防模型

第二章作业

第三章 传统计算机病毒

3.1DOS病毒

3.2宏病毒

第三章 传统计算机病毒(2)

3.3 Windows可执行文件病毒

第三章作业

第四章 Linux系统下的病毒

4.1 Linux病毒概述

4.2 Shell及ELF病毒

第四章作业

第五章 木马

5.1 木马概念

5.2 木马植入技术

第五章 木马(2)

5.3 木马隐藏技术

5.4 实验视频

第五章作业

第六章 智能手机恶意代码

6.1 手机恶意代码

6.2 手机恶意代码防范

第六章作业

第七章 蠕虫

7.1 蠕虫

第七章作业

第八章 勒索型恶意代码

8.1 勒索软件

8.2 勒索软件实验

第八章作业

第九章 其他新型恶意代码

9.1 脚本恶意代码

9.2 僵尸网络

9.3 APT

第九章作业

第十章恶意代码检测技术

10.1恶意代码检测

特征码检查实验

第十章恶意代码检测技术(2)

10.2 数据备份及恢复

10.3 静态识别方法

10.4 动态识别方法

第十章作业

第十一章防范方案

11.1评测机构

11.2防范方案

第十一章作业

第十二章防范策略与法律法规

视频